Assembly for Reverse Engineers

Assembly for Reverse Engineers Training

ATA Logo

Assembly for Reverse Engineers

Many analysts and programmers have not yet learned assembly language – a skill that will save them precious time when effective analysis is needed most. Designed for malware analysts and code developers alike, Assembly for Reverse Engineers will equip you with the know-how to effectively read Assembly, review statements, and reverse machine code back to its higher-level equivalent.

Training at a glance

Level

Intermediate

Duration

5 days

Experience

2 years: Programming & Security

Average Salary

$146,617

Labs

Yes

Level

Intermediate

Duration

5 days

Experience

2 years: Programming & Security

Average Salary

               

Labs

Yes

Training Details

Assembly for Reverse Engineers (ARE) is designed for Behavioral Malware Analysts looking to make the leap into malware reverse engineers, and developers looking to explore the world of reverse engineering. The course focuses on developing techniques to improve the speed and quality of static analysis. Students will be equipped with the know-how to effectively read assembly, review  statements, understand program flow, identify the influence of different compilers and reverse machine code back to its higher-level equivalent.

Lesson 1: Describe code execution within the x86 architecture

Lesson 2: Demonstrate knowledge of x86 core architecture components

Lesson 3: Perform static and dynamic disassembly analysis toward the reverse engineering of Windows executables

Lesson 4: Infer appropriate application of dynamic analysis techniques

Lesson 5: Apply IDA Pro’s powerful assembly markup features to optimize analysis

Lesson 6: Utilize static and dynamic analysis to interpret and document program flow

  • Security Analysts who need to reverse engineer malware and other software
  • Incident Responders and Forensic Investigators seeking to learn advanced investigation techniques
  • Software Developers who want to write more efficient, more secure
  • Experience with C programming in a Windows environment
  • Successful completion of Understanding Operating Systems course (or equivalent knowledge)

Upcoming Classes

We offer more than just Assembly for Reverse Engineers Training

Our successful training results keep our corporate and military clients returning.
That’s because we provide everything you need to succeed. This is true for all of our courses.

Strategic Planning & Project Management

From Lean Six Sigma to Project Management Institute Project Management Professional, Agile and SCRUM, we offer the best-in-class strategic planning and project management training available. Work closely with our seasoned multi-decade project managers.

IT & Cybersecurity

ATA is the leading OffSec and Hack the Box US training provider, and a CompTIA and EC-Council award-winning training partner. We offer the best offensive and defensive cyber training to keep your team ahead of the technology skills curve.

Leadership & Management

Let us teach your team the high-level traits and micro-level tools & strategies of effective 21st-century leadership. Empower your team to play to each others’ strengths, inspire others and build a culture that values communication, authenticity, and community.

From Lean Six Sigma to Project Management Institute Project Management Professional, Agile and SCRUM, we offer the best-in-class strategic planning and project management training available. Work closely with our seasoned multi-decade project managers.
ATA is the leading OffSec and Hack the Box US training provider, and a CompTIA and EC-Council award-winning training partner. We offer the best offensive and defensive cyber training to keep your team ahead of the technology skills curve.
Let us teach your team the high-level traits and micro-level tools & strategies of effective 21st-century leadership. Empower your team to play to each others’ strengths, inspire others and build a culture that values communication, authenticity, and community.

Get Practical Experience That Well Over 95% Of Assembly for Reverse Engineers (Classroom)Job Openings Require.

Our training doesn’t consist of a set of video lectures followed by unguided work assignments, as is the case with all other Assembly for Reverse Engineers (Classroom) training programs.

Instead, our proprietary Artificial Intelligence-based training platform delivers you bite-sized knowledge that is immediately followed by hands-on exercises, during which the platform watches your every step and helps you with contextual help, hints, and templates, as needed; and you have a personal tutor and coach who help you every step of the way.